Tottenham joins bid for Luis Díaz, possible offer, Liverpool competition | Colombians Abroad

Luis Díaz is back on the Premier League’s radar … in fact, he hasn’t been out of there in over six months.

The attacker has been repeatedly mentioned as Liverpool’s target and Newcastle is also mentioned, but now there would be a third party in contention, one that was mentioned in the past.

It is about Tottenham, a team that in the past, when Mourinho was DT, would have expressed interest.

UK media assure that the Colombian has been being evaluated for months and that a first offer to Porto would have already taken place, for no less than 60 million euros. The answer? No thanks.

The 24-year-old is in no rush and neither is his team. They would wait for the summer market and not give in to the pressure, not even for such a tempting offer. If no one appears with 80 million euros, the value of the termination clause, there will be patience.

Coach Sergio Sérgio Conceição had already given the idea that there would be no way to retain him: “we cannot guess what is going to happen. The players have a termination clause, if they pay it we can do nothing,” said the DT.

As it is, the market will continue to move and Díaz will remain on the radar of many. But from confirmed news, nothing for now.
